 The staff of Pasa la Voz in Peru exists of:

Liesbeth KerstensLiesbeth Kerstens, co-founder and president of both Pasa la Voz and the Dutch Hoedje van Papier foundation. She is responsible for the co-ordination of the various projects of both Pasa la Voz as well as Hoedje van Papier. She studied Cultural Management, Theater Sciences and International Development Studies, in Amsterdam in The Netherlands.  Liesbeth has lived in Peru since 2000 where she has gained a lot of experience in working with various development projects. From Peru she additionally works for Mano, in Rotterdam in The Netherlands, in the areas of fundraising, project management and consultancy for development organizations in countries such as Peru, Guatemala and Brazil.

 

Martin Maletta GoyaMartin Maletta Goya, co-founder and president of Pasa la Voz. He is also responsible for the content and co-ordination of the workshops and publication of the various products the kids produce. He is a photographer, multimedia artist and documentary maker in the field of education.

He has worked for and with various organizations that aim their activities at kids, where he set up workshops and coordinated the activities. Also, has he worked for various Peruvian media organizations where he worked as a photographer and a producer.

 

 

Tania Castro GonzalesTania Castro Gonzales, has been involved in Pasa la Voz from the very beginning and she is responsible for the training modules of the workshops. She trains teachers of Pasa la Voz in the area of pedagogy and creativity. She also gives the workshops photography and journalism and creative writing. For the teachers and tutors of the Pasa la Voz network she gives in-house capacity building courses. The past ten years Tania has worked for Pukllasunchis as a teacher and as co-producer of a radio show for communities in the Andes. She was also in charge of the virtual literature project ENREDOS of the Telefonica foundation. And she was part of the Cuban Council for developing the educational program. Finally, Tania has years of experience in working with street kids and working kids in amongst others Qosqo Maki, Huchuy Runa and the theater group Impulso.
